What Are The Requirements for Becoming
a Tax Franchise Owner?
If you are looking to own a tax franchise, it's a good
idea to make sure you meet the requirements.
You must have a passion for what you
do. You need to be a hard worker and be willing to devote yourself to the tax
business. As tax franchise owner you will most likely work long and stressful
hours during tax season. Owning a franchise does provide guidance and support
for the successful operation of your tax prep business. However, ultimately success
is in the hands of the tax franchise owner him or herself. A tax service franchise owner needs to have a solid business
background or at least a good business sense. Practical tax business experience
isn't necessary, however you must be able to hire great tax accountants and manage
them properly.
Some other requirements to owning a tax franchise cover the financial aspect.
Most tax franchise companies require their potential franchisees have a net worth
of $100K - $200K and a cash liquidity of $50K. If you do not have
the cash available to cover the total investment of $49K - $95K, then you must
have a good enough credit history to get financing from a 3rd party lender. |
